According to The Sun, Ollie Watkins wants to move to Manchester United if the Reds cannot sign a contract with Benjamin Sesko from RB Leipzig.
MU has now made an offer worth 85 million euros (£ 73.8 million) to sign a contract with Benjamin Sesko from RB Leipzig, but this Bundesliga club is also considering the same offer from Newcastle. Sesko has not yet made its final decision on his future, although sources in Slovenia on Friday last week said the 22 -year -old chose to join Newcastle.
MU has alternative options for Sesko, who scored 13 goals in the Bundesliga last season. In case the 22 -year -old striker refuses to move to Old Trafford, the Red Man will target Ollie Watkins of Aston Villa.

Last month, MU was informed that the 29 -year -old was not for sale. Aston Villa also refused the offer worth £ 60 million for Watkins from Arsenal at the end of the January transfer period.
According to The Sun, Watkins believes that it is now the right time to leave, while Aston Villa will consider the offer worth £ 50 million for their striker, who scored 16 Premier League victories last season.
The source also revealed that MU also brought Samu Aghehowa on the shortlist, who scored 27 goals for Porto last season and almost joined Chelsea a year ago. Benfica's 26 -year -old striker, Vangelis Pavlidis, who scored 30 goals last season, was also in MU's sights.
MU had previously refused to recruit Nicolas Jackson because Chelsea demanded £ 80 million for his star.
